Package: spamassassin
Version: 3.1.0a-1
Severity: normal

syslog says:

Dec 14 16:01:57 chain spamd[527]: prefork: server reached --max-clients 
setting, consider raising it

but I don't see anything in the documentation, or in google, that
says how to change "--max-clients" for spamd.
